Roofing evaluation services involve a comprehensive assessment of a property's roof condition to identify existing issues and potential problems. These evaluations typically include a visual inspection of the roof’s surface, flashing, gutters, and other components, as well as an assessment of the underlying structure. Some providers may also utilize specialized tools or techniques, such as drone inspections or moisture scans, to gain a detailed understanding of the roof’s condition. The goal is to provide property owners with a clear picture of the roof’s current state, highlighting areas that may require repair, maintenance, or replacement.
This service helps address common roofing problems such as leaks, damaged shingles, deteriorated flashing, or structural weaknesses that could lead to more significant issues if left unaddressed. By identifying these problems early, property owners can plan appropriate repairs or replacements, potentially avoiding costly damage to the interior or structure of the building. Roof evaluations also assist in determining the remaining lifespan of the existing roof, which is especially valuable for properties considering renovation or sale.

Inspection Costs - Roof inspection services typically range from $150 to $400, depending on the size and complexity of the roof. For example, a standard residential roof in Toms River might cost around $200 for a thorough evaluation.
Assessment Fees - Comprehensive roof assessments often cost between $200 and $600, with larger or multi-story properties tending toward the higher end. These evaluations help identify potential issues before they become costly repairs.
Evaluation Service Rates - Roof evaluation services generally fall within the $100 to $350 range, varying based on the scope and local market conditions. A basic evaluation for a small home may be closer to $100, while extensive inspections may reach $350.
Additional Costs - Some providers may charge extra for detailed reports or additional diagnostic testing, which can add $50 to $200 to the overall cost. Contact local pros for specific pricing tailored to individual property needs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is a roofing evaluation? A roofing evaluation involves a professional assessment of a roof's condition to identify any damage, wear, or potential issues that may need attention.
How often should a roof be evaluated? It is recommended to have a roof evaluated at least once a year or after severe weather events to ensure its integrity.
What signs indicate that a roof may need an evaluation? Visible issues such as missing shingles, leaks, sagging, or significant granule loss can suggest the need for a roofing assessment.
What can I expect during a roofing evaluation? A professional will inspect the roof's surface, flashing, gutters, and attic (if accessible) to assess overall condition and identify potential problems.
